Description

I created a custom CRS based on a state plane, and added a +k_0 parameter to make ground references in an image measure correctly.

I reprojected a layer of existing vectors into this new CRS in a temporary/memory layer. The features projected correctly onto the map.

However, when I used "Layer/Save As..." to save to a file, the saved layer "jumped" to a new location (tested with both geopackage and shapefiles, same behavior).
The CRS listed in the Source Tab for the layer properties is NOT my named custom projection, but a USER:100.... that does not include a +k_0 parameter.

When I select my custom projection to change the CRS, the feature jumps back to its proper location.

So apparently, when saving a layer to a file, not all of the PROJ4 parameters are being included in the CRS of the saved file. This may affect more parameters than just scaling, but I have not tested any others.
